Rocky Road Nests

You will need:
some chocolate - we used about 150g milk chocolate.
a tablespoon of butter
a tablespoon of chocolate spread

2 digestive biscuits
a mini pack of cereal (we used cornflakes, as O found a mini box of them in the cupboard and wanted to play with them)
some other stuff - we used
a handful of raisins
a handful of mini marshmallows
half a tube of smarties


To make these:

Melt the chocolate/butter/chocolate spread in a microwave - 30 seconds, stir, then 10 second bursts until it's smooth.

Stir in the cereal and other stuff (you could add nuts, white chocolate chunks, glace cherries, chopped dried apricots, maltesers, broken up pretzels - basically whatever you find in the cupboards).  break up the biscuits into chunks and stir them in too.

Spoon a dessert spoon of the mixture in to cupcake wrappers in a cupcake or muffin tin, and try to make them vaguely nest shaped with the spoon.

Chill them in the fridge until set, then stick a mini chick or some mini eggs in them to serve.
